EZGO TXT Robin 295cc EH29C
Hi!
So I got a rebuild kit for my engine, took my engine out and replaced all the gaskets. I put the engine back in and tested. After a few hours of driving it around I noticed an oil leak. I figured I messed up something. Turns out the oil is leaking from the dipstick guide area and the overflow tube. I don't know why it would leak from the overflow because it only has a little over 3/4 of oil in it. Does anyone know how I can change the seal on the dipstick guide? Do I just pull the guide out or do I need to take the engine apart again.... :( See image.. https://www.dropbox.com/s/uv7csz7hnz..._3624.JPG?dl=0 Last edited by ymha02; 11-30-2017 at 11:41 AM.. Re: EZGO TXT Robin 295cc EH29C
Pull the tube and if there’s an o ring , replace it. If not put some silicone on it.
